Not to put us down mate, but I don't think we're what you're looking for. Outside the states footballs a fringe sport, so there's no money for scholarships. Also I'm not sure if its the case for the rest of Europe, but in the UK as we don't use our universities as feeder programmes for professional sports, theres hardly any money even if you play a mainstream sport such as soccer at a high level. That being said Warwick is a great place to study and if you came you'd be a welcome addition to the team. Good luck in your search mate. |
